Transaction 64777b95a3891c0796e0426afd88a852086c7b0305c701c93aefb1251d54d384

2 Input
2 Outputs
  • 64777b95a3891c0796e0426afd88a852086c7b0305c701c93aefb1251d54d384:0
  • value  168433
    address  1JaV9CZMchecmUHywqQFeWGj3bTEHkNcy4
  • 64777b95a3891c0796e0426afd88a852086c7b0305c701c93aefb1251d54d384:1
  • value  347170
    address  137ucaTvdtsG8yWADSsCverZoYSwWnePjS